Message type: E = Error
Message class: CRM_IC_AUI - Messages for Agent's Universal Inbox
Message number: 046
Message text: Finish interaction first

- Finish interaction first ?The SAP error message CRM_IC_AUI046: "Finish interaction first" typically occurs in the SAP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system, particularly in the Interaction Center (IC) when a user attempts to perform an action that requires the current interaction to be completed or finalized first.
Cause:
This error usually arises in the following scenarios:
- Incomplete Interaction: The user is trying to navigate away from or perform an action on an interaction that has not been completed. For example, if there are unsaved changes or if the interaction is still in progress.
- System Configuration: Certain configurations in the CRM system may enforce that interactions must be finalized before proceeding with other tasks.
- User Permissions: The user may not have the necessary permissions to complete the interaction or perform the desired action.
Solution:
To resolve the error, you can take the following steps:
Complete the Interaction:
- Ensure that all required fields in the interaction are filled out.
- Save any changes made during the interaction.
- If there are any pending actions (like sending an email or logging a call), complete those actions.
Check for Unsaved Changes:
- Look for any prompts or indicators that suggest there are unsaved changes. Save the interaction before attempting to perform any other actions.
Review System Configuration:
- If you have access, check the configuration settings in the CRM system to ensure that the interaction completion rules are set correctly.
User Permissions:
- Verify that you have the necessary permissions to complete the interaction. If not, contact your system administrator to adjust your user role or permissions.
Log Out and Log Back In:
- Sometimes, simply logging out of the system and logging back in can resolve temporary issues.
Consult Documentation or Support:
- If the issue persists, refer to SAP documentation or reach out to your SAP support team for further assistance.
